Key Features (Common across the CMI Home Safe range, specific details vary by model):

  • Robust Steel Construction:
    • Features durable steel plate doors (typically 8mm to 12mm thick) and solid steel bodies (ranging from 4mm to 6mm thick).
    • Often includes reinforced steel bars around front edges and rear dog bars for enhanced pry resistance.
  • Reliable Locking Mechanisms:
    • Standard Key Lock: High-quality, pick-resistant key locks (e.g., Ross 700).
    • Electronic Digital Lock: User-friendly keypads with external battery compartments for quick and convenient access.
    • Mechanical Combination Lock: Robust, traditional combination locks for dependable security.
  • Fire Protection (on many models):
    • Designed to provide 30 minutes or 60 minutes of fire resistance for paper documents, incorporating expanding fire seals around the door frame to protect contents from heat.
  • Burglary Resistance:
    • Equipped with solid steel locking bolts (e.g., 25mm to 32mm diameter) for multi-directional locking.
    • Many models include secondary or emergency relocking devices that automatically activate upon attack.
    • Anti-jack hinges deter forceful entry attempts.
  • Versatile Internal Organisation:
    • Most models come with one or more adjustable shelves to allow for flexible storage of various-sized items.
  • Secure Installation:
    • All safes are provided with pre-drilled bolt holes (in the base and/or back) for secure anchoring to a concrete floor or wall, which is crucial for maximizing security and preventing removal.
  • Cash Rating:
    • Typically carry an unsupported cash rating ranging from $5,000 to $50,000, depending on the specific model’s construction and certifications.
  • Firearms Compliance:
    • Smaller models are often compliant with Australian firearm storage levels (e.g., Category A, B, C, D & H for pistols) when correctly bolted down.
  • Australian Quality & Warranty:
    • Proudly designed and manufactured to CMI’s high standards in Australia.
    • Backed by a 5-year warranty on safe construction and a 24-month warranty on locks
